Jumbo Loans and What They Actually Mean for Coastal Buyers
Jumbo loans are a necessity for many buyers in Rowayton, where rowayton houses for sale often exceed the conventional loan limit. To qualify for a jumbo loan, buyers must meet stricter lender requirements, including higher credit scores and larger down payments. Understanding these nuances is crucial for buyers who want to navigate the market successfully.
Qualification Nuances
Lenders expect jumbo loan borrowers to have a strong credit profile, with credit scores typically above 700. Additionally, lenders often require a higher down payment, typically 20% or more, to mitigate the risk of lending large amounts.
Lender Expectations
Lenders also expect jumbo loan borrowers to have a stable income and a low debt-to-income ratio. This means that buyers must be able to demonstrate a consistent income stream and a manageable level of debt.

Flood Insurance, Elevation Certificates, and the Costs Buyers Miss
Flood insurance is a critical consideration for buyers of waterfront properties in Rowayton. The cost of flood insurance can add thousands of dollars to the annual carrying costs of a property, and buyers who fail to factor this into their budget may be in for a painful surprise. Elevation certificates, which determine the flood risk of a property, can also have a significant impact on insurance costs.
Flood Insurance Costs
The cost of flood insurance can vary widely depending on the location and elevation of a property. Buyers should factor in the cost of flood insurance when determining their budget and should work with a knowledgeable insurance agent to understand their options.

Building Your Financing Stack Before You Make an Offer
Before making an offer on a property, buyers should have a solid financing stack in place. This includes a pre-approval letter, a clear understanding of their budget, and a plan for managing closing costs.
